___wastes are solid, liquid, or gas wastes that are toxic, flammable, corrosive, reactive, or radioactive.a. solid
b. hazardous
c. domestic

Answers

Answer 1
Answer:

Answer: Option (b) is the correct answer.

Explanation:

When a substance is used and thrown away which can lead to damage in the environment as it may [produce some toxic or hazardous gases is known as a hazardous waste.

These wastes can be solid, liquid or gaseous.

For example, batteries, kerosene, garden chemicals etc are all hazardous waste.

A domestic waste is a waste thrown by a household which may include paper, vegetable waste, cardboard, yard clippings etc.

Thus, we can conclude that hazardous wastes are solid, liquid, or gas wastes that are toxic, flammable, corrosive, reactive, or radioactive.

Give two reasons why a gold ring is not made of 100% gold.

Answers

Gold is extremely malleable in its purest form, so a 24-carat (pure) gold ring would be very easy to get dented and squashed during the time that it is being worn.
It is also extremely expensive to process gold to its purest form, so pure gold jewelry would be ridiculously expensive, to the point of no demand.

As the temperature of a liquid increases, its vapor pressure(1) decreases
(2) increases
(3) remains the same

Answers

As the temperature of liquid increases, its vapor pressure increases. Therefore, option (2) is correct.

What is vapour pressure?

Vapour pressure can be defined as the pressure exerted by a vapor with its condensed phases in a closed system at a given temperature. The equilibrium vapor pressure is also served as an indicator of the rate of evaporation of a liquid.  

A material that has a high vapor pressure at normal temperatures is commonly referred to as a volatile material. The pressure exhibited by the molecules of the gas above a liquid surface is called vapor pressure.

The temperature and the vapor pressure of liquid are directly related to each other. If the temperature of the liquid increases, more gasmolecules have the energy to escape from the surface of the liquid.

Therefore, the vapor pressure increases with an increase in the temperature of the liquid.

Which ion is the only negative ion present in an aqueous solution of an Arrhenius base?(1) hydride ion (3) hydronium ion
(2) hydrogen ion (4) hydroxide ion

Answers

The correct answer is option 4. It is the hydroxide ions that is produced by an Arrhenius base in water. According to Arrhenius, acid-base reactions are characterized by acids which forms hydronium ions in water and bases which dissociates in aqueous solution to form hydroxide ions. 

How do you find the name of the chemical formula Pb3N4 (the 3 and 4 are subscripts)

Answers

This is a salt because there is a cation and an anion.  Because lead can have multiple charges, its charge must correspond to the charge of the anion.  The charge on the N is -3, so the 4 N's equal a total charge of -12. Therefore, the total charge of the 3 Pb's must be 12, so each lead should have a charge of +4.  So the name of the compound is Lead (IV) Nitride.
